
Pep Guardiola has warned his Manchester City stars that they still have work to do despite the 3-0 first-leg quarter-final victory over Bayern Munich.
“When you are there you realise how good they are as a team,” Guardiola told BT Sport.
“For 55, 60 minutes it was a tight, tight game. In a lot of moments they were better than us, but after 65 minutes we got the second goal and that helped us a lot.
“We made some changes and our pressing was more effective. They were finding Musiala, what an exceptional player he is. And Gnabry, the threat from Coman and Leroy in behind, how fast they are. It’s really, really difficult.
“I am happy for the result but I lived in Munich for three years. I know at Bayern Munich the mentality and I know the quality they have. Still a strong game to do.”
